What Features Should You Look For in a Battery Operated Leaf Blower?

When searching for the best rated battery operated leaf blower, consider the following features:

  • Battery Life: Look for a leaf blower with a long-lasting battery that can run for at least 30-60 minutes on a single charge. This ensures you can complete your yard work without frequent recharging interruptions.
  • Weight and Ergonomics: A lightweight design and comfortable grip make the blower easier to maneuver, especially during prolonged use. Ergonomic features can reduce fatigue, allowing you to work efficiently.
  • Air Speed and Volume: Check the blower’s air speed (measured in MPH) and volume (measured in CFM) to determine its effectiveness. Higher air speeds and volumes enable faster clearing of leaves and debris, making your tasks easier and quicker.
  • Noise Level: Opt for a model that operates at a lower decibel level to minimize noise pollution, especially if you live in a residential area. Many battery operated models are designed to be quieter than gas-powered alternatives.
  • Charging Time: A shorter charging time allows for quicker turnaround between uses. Some models offer fast-charging capabilities, which can be convenient for larger jobs that require more than one battery charge.
  • Build Quality and Durability: Assess the material and construction of the blower to ensure it can withstand regular use and various weather conditions. A well-built blower will typically last longer and perform better over time.
  • Multi-functionality: Some leaf blowers come with attachments or settings that allow them to function as vacuums or mulchers. This versatility can enhance their value by providing additional options for yard care.
  • Warranty and Customer Support: A good warranty can provide peace of mind regarding the blower’s reliability and performance. Quality customer support is also important for addressing any issues or concerns that may arise during ownership.

What Advantages Do Battery Operated Leaf Blowers Have Over Gas and Corded Options?

The environmental impact of battery operated leaf blowers is minimal, as they emit no harmful fumes or greenhouse gases during operation. This eco-friendly aspect appeals to environmentally conscious consumers who want to reduce their carbon footprint while maintaining their gardens.

Maintenance is simplified with battery operated models since they lack many of the mechanical components found in gas blowers. Users do not need to worry about regular oil changes, fuel mixtures, or other upkeep, which makes these blowers more convenient for those who want to focus on their landscaping tasks.

Ease of use is a standout feature, as these blowers start instantly with a simple button press, eliminating the frustration of traditional gas models that may require multiple attempts to start. This straightforward operation is particularly beneficial for those who may not be mechanically inclined.

Cost efficiency is realized over time, as users do not need to purchase fuel, and the lower maintenance costs can lead to savings. Although the initial investment in a quality battery operated leaf blower might be higher, the long-term savings and convenience often justify the expense.
